Parc Saint Cyr: A Haven of Tranquility in Laval

In the heart of Laval, nestled between bustling streets and the serene shores of the Rivière des Mille Îles, lies Parc Saint Cyr, an urban oasis that offers a sanctuary of tranquility and endless opportunities for outdoor recreation. Originally established in the 1960s, this sprawling park encompasses over 100 hectares of natural beauty, boasting lush green spaces, sparkling waterways, and a diverse array of flora and fauna. Parc Saint Cyr is a testament to the harmonious coexistence of nature and urban development, providing a haven for both wildlife and city dwellers seeking respite from the hustle and bustle of everyday life.

History The history of Parc Saint Cyr is intertwined with the rich tapestry of Laval's past. Once part of the vast Seigneury of Mille Îles, the land where the park now stands was originally inhabited by Indigenous peoples. In the 17th century, French settlers arrived in the area and established farms and mills along the riverbanks. Over time, as Laval grew and developed, the need for green spaces became increasingly apparent, leading to the creation of Parc Saint Cyr in the 1960s. Today, the park serves as a cherished gathering place for locals and visitors alike, offering a tranquil retreat from the urban landscape and a chance to reconnect with nature's wonders.
